WMER (1390 AM) is a Gospel radio station broadcasting in the Meridian, Mississippi,[2] Arbitron market.

History

[edit]

WMER was owned by former Mississippi State Senator Brad Carter, who died on July 1, 2024.[3]

Translator

[edit]

WMER is also heard on 93.1 FM, through a translator in Meridian, Mississippi.[4]
